Possible Causes of A/C Drain Overflow
An overflowing drain line from your air conditioning unit can happen for several reasons. Often, it starts with a clog in the condensate drain pipe, which prevents excess moisture from draining properly. These clogs can be caused by dirt, mold, algae, or debris buildup over time. When the drain line becomes blocked, water tends to back up, leading to overflow and potential water damage in your property.
Another common cause is a crack or damage within the condensate drain pan or pipe itself. Age, wear and tear, or improper installation can lead to leaks, cracks, or breaks in these components. This allows water to escape uncontrollably, causing water damage and increasing the risk of mold growth. Environmental factors like high humidity or stagnant water can also contribute to these issues, making regular maintenance essential.

Can a clogged drain line cause water damage?
Yes, a clogged AC drain line can lead to water overflow, which may cause significant water damage to floors, walls, and ceilings if not addressed promptly. Regular maintenance can help prevent this issue.
How do I know if my A/C drain line is clogged?

How often should I have my A/C drain line checked?
We recommend scheduling professional inspections at least once a year, especially before peak cooling seasons, to ensure your system remains clear and functional.
What steps can I take to prevent future overflows?
Regularly changing or cleaning the air filter, keeping the drain line free of debris, and scheduling routine professional maintenance can significantly reduce the risk of overflow issues.
